Packet sniffing is important in network monitoring to troubleshoot and to log network activities which will benefit both the network software engineers and network engineers. In this research work, we specifically designed and implemented a new and efficient software based IPv6 capable packet sniffer, V6SNIFF. Performance analysis has been done on two different approaches which are the libpcap implementation and raw socket implementation in designing packet sniffing software in an open source operating platform, Linux. The results have been analyzed and taken into consideration in designing V6SNIFF. Raw socket implementation outperforms the former in IPv6 packet sniffing and V6SNIFF chose it as the building platform. Performance analysis was done as well comparing our specifically designed V6SNIFF with one of the well known network analyzer, TCPDUMP. V6SNIFF outperforms the later in capturing IPv6 packets and the metrics of the performance analysis will be exhibited in this paper. This documented report contributes to other research work involving IPv6 to decide on which approaches suitable to be implemented in their context and provides an alternative tool, V6SNIFF in packet monitoring.
